If you are talking about an incandescent light bulb then its called a filament. It is thin so that it has a high level of resistance. Current going through the filament causes it to heat up and give off EM radiation in the spectrum of visible light.

What is a DC light bulb?

It is a light bulb that runs on direct current which is current that is steady unlike alternating current that switches every fiftieth or sixtieth of a second. However, this distinction is not important on incandescent bulbs since they can be powered in either direction. When heating a coil of wire, it doesn't matter if the current only flows in one direction (DC) or alternates. The only things that matter are the voltage and amount of current available.

What One of the factors allowing DNA to fit inside the nucleus of a cell is its ability to?

One of the factors allowing DNA to fit inside the nucleus of a cell is its ability to coil and condense into a highly organized structure. DNA achieves this by wrapping around proteins called histones to form nucleosomes, which then coil up further to form chromatin fibers. This packaging of DNA allows it to be tightly packed within the nucleus without becoming tangled.

How does a dynamo light work to generate electricity for illumination?

A dynamo light works by using a magnet and a coil of wire to generate electricity. When the bike wheel turns, it spins the magnet inside the coil, creating a magnetic field that induces a current in the wire. This current powers the light bulb, providing illumination.

How could you use a magnet to make the bulb light up?

This may take quite a bit of effort, as most incandescent light bulbs use a fair bit of current. Find the smallest bulb with the lowest operating voltage, from a small flashlight. Get as many turns as you can from your piece of wire, wrapping it around and around. Connect the bulb across the ends of the wire. One end goes to the centre contact and the other to the side of the bulb. (assuming a small Edison screw type bulb.) Now move the magnet rapidly inside the coil you made with the wire. The lamp will only blink during the movement of the magnet. By rapidly moving the magnet back and forth, you can generate an almost continuous supply of AC current and keep the bulb alight.
